你查询的IP:[118.89.26.39]  地理位置:中国–广东–广州

最新查询202.96.77.245 61.236.202.2 202.192.164.72 123.52.161.82 118.84.216.14 221.223.242.14 120.137.160.18 118.80.151.214 210.5.129.20 118.89.26.39 116.112.204.12 210.25.128.178 202.95.252.46 192.83.122.135 122.224.187.200 221.129.175.225 121.204.190.54 202.46.224.160 203.184.80.30 221.196.182.101 120.94.86.109 202.20.120.80 118.72.30.74 116.90.184.25 125.98.51.212 117.72.0.138 60.208.126.3 124.47.3.158 210.22.86.77 210.5.202.202 58.16.225.155